[DAGCombine] Do not remove masking argument to FP16_TO_FP for some targets
As of commit 284f2bffc9bc5, the DAG Combiner gets rid of the masking of the input to this node if the mask only keeps the bottom 16 bits. This is because the underlying library function does not use the high order bits. However, on PowerPC's ELFv2 ABI, it is the caller that is responsible for clearing the bits from the register. Therefore, the library implementation of __gnu_h2f_ieee will return an incorrect result if the bits aren't cleared. This combine is desired for ARM (and possibly other targets) so this patch adds a query to Target Lowering to check if this zeroing needs to be kept.
